1. A person does not commit an offense under section 570.030 if, at the time of the appropriation, he or she:

(1) Acted in the honest belief that he had the right to do so; or

(2) Acted in the honest belief that the owner, if present, would have consented to the appropriation.

2. The defendant shall have the burden of injecting the issue of claim of right.
